The automotive industry is embracing digital transformation, and car maintenance is no exception. In 2025, vehicle owners increasingly rely on mobile solutions to manage their vehicle health, schedule services, track expenses, and receive alerts. If you're planning to develop a car maintenance app, now is the perfect time to enter this growing market with an innovative solution. This comprehensive guide covers everything you need to know about car maintenance app development, from planning and features to tech stack and cost.
With the global automotive service market expected to grow significantly, digital car care solutions are becoming a necessity rather than a luxury. Car owners seek convenience, reminders, and digital records, while service centers look for better customer engagement tools. Developing a car maintenance app allows businesses to tap into:
To develop a car maintenance app that delivers value, you need to integrate essential features that enhance the user experience and streamline vehicle management. Here are the must-have features:
Allow users to sign up using email, phone number, or social media. They should be able to create profiles for themselves and register multiple vehicles.
Enable users to input key details about their vehicle including make, model, year, VIN, mileage, and insurance information. The app should store service history, warranties, and inspection records.
Offer automatic alerts for oil changes, tire rotations, brake checks, battery replacements, and more. Reminders can be based on mileage, time, or calendar settings.
Integrate with local garages and service centers to allow users to book appointments directly through the app. Include features like availability calendar, booking history, and live status tracking.
Maintain digital records of all past services, inspections, part replacements, and repairs. This helps in resale value and warranty claims.
Let users track fuel purchases, repairs, part replacements, and other car-related expenses. Generate monthly or yearly reports for budgeting.
Send timely push notifications for due services, promotions, or emergency recalls.
Use location data to help users find nearby mechanics, car washes, gas stations, or auto part stores.
Integrate secure payment gateways so users can pay for services directly within the app.
Add features like roadside assistance, towing service contacts, and accident reporting options.
To develop a car maintenance app effectively, follow this structured development process:
Start with deep market research to identify gaps in existing apps like myCARFAX, AUTOsist, or Simply Auto. Understand your audience—individual car owners, fleet operators, or auto service providers.
Decide whether your app will be free with ads, subscription-based, freemium, or transaction-based. Clearly define the unique value proposition of your app.
Prepare detailed wireframes and user flow diagrams. This helps define the user journey and interface requirements.
For a scalable and efficient app, select the right tech stack:
Build an MVP with core features like user registration, vehicle info, maintenance reminders, and scheduling. This helps validate your app idea quickly and get early feedback.
Conduct extensive testing including functionality testing, UI/UX testing, performance testing, and security checks.
Deploy the app to Play Store and App Store. Promote through digital marketing and collect user feedback to make improvements.
After launch, scale the app by adding new features like AI-driven diagnostic tools, integration with OBD2 devices, or fleet management dashboards.
The cost to develop a car maintenance app depends on the complexity, design, and development team location. Here is a rough estimate:
Factors influencing the cost:
The demand for smart automotive solutions is on the rise, and 2025 is a great year to invest in car maintenance app development. Whether you’re a startup, an automotive business, or a software development company, building a car maintenance app can help you cater to the evolving needs of vehicle owners. By focusing on essential features, seamless user experience, and continuous improvement, you can develop a car maintenance app that stands out in a competitive market.
1. Why should I develop a car maintenance app in 2025?
Car maintenance apps are in high demand due to the rise in vehicle ownership, the need for digital service management, and user preference for mobile-first solutions.
2. What platform should I build the app for?
It’s ideal to develop the app for both Android and iOS using cross-platform frameworks like Flutter or React Native to reach a wider audience.
3. Can the app integrate with vehicle hardware?
Yes, you can integrate with OBD2 devices to pull real-time vehicle diagnostics data, which enhances app functionality and user experience.
4. How long does it take to develop a car maintenance app?
Depending on the complexity, it can take anywhere from 2 to 6 months to develop a car maintenance app.
5. How can I monetize a car maintenance app?
Monetization strategies include in-app ads, subscription models, paid premium features, affiliate partnerships with garages, or service fee commissions.
6. Can I hire a development company for this app?
Yes, hiring an experienced mobile app development company ensures that your app is built professionally, with the latest technologies and compliance standards.